Output c623e7fdd7b67b83fc1c5ab6c40dcd8f3534a51b9f67c03989ef66604ea02a23:1

value
790646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a53ac9def8bb11bae3bab9049aa6e74a48cf3504 OP_EQUAL
address
3GkfqtwqjNRiJEhfexr14BnPwhSPq8zgKS
transaction
c623e7fdd7b67b83fc1c5ab6c40dcd8f3534a51b9f67c03989ef66604ea02a23
spent
true